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
82 73 65366352554 62161634155 79504914
84 24 6852415335
84 24 6852415335
59946537 7714005 65894065 82639358748
All about undefined
Interested in learning more?
84 24 6852415335
59946537 7714005 65894065 82639358748
See more
78429385 18525031
0366148 153697 7380751
See more
71953758472 833345
83 58027 96259238
See more